Transaction b345325808a68c8316a5ecef1f38fd72fc218d961df1a3ad98239fcf2214ad91
1 Input
1 Output
-
b345325808a68c8316a5ecef1f38fd72fc218d961df1a3ad98239fcf2214ad91:0
- value
- 520000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e80987cd63c92dac9d78457d41c32b7d20317e2 OP_EQUAL
- address
- 3QthcFY2sVpWTykVLMwpKCMRyQUnbGH3kE